| Hello WFO's I've been reading the forums and I feel I am well equipped to start a new corner build for a 42" oven w/ outdoor kitchen. I am looking for input on building on an existing patio/slab. The slab was poured on very hard clay, with 8" footers poured. There is approx. 6" of gravel fill below the slab. The slab was not reinforced with rebar. There is a pic below. My questions are: Is this sufficient for the weight of the oven? Should an additional foundation slab be poured atop the existing slab? If not, should I drill into the existing slab to set the rebar for the frame? Any help is greatly appreciated. I will continue to post pics of my build. |

| You don't say how thick the slab is, but it should probably be 4" thick. If you don't have any idea how thick it is, you can drill a small hole through it to test for its thickness. |
